Yes 100% and its a BuckMaster variation #4 , with that stamp of " BUCK,184<(1986 stamp code ) U.S.A.,PAT.PEND." about 45,452 were produced from Oct 1985 till Dec 1986 with this stamp on the blade...Send it to BUCK and for about $25 plus shipping they can make it look new..I like that you have everything there, both pouches large and small, silva #12 compass, sheath, pins pommel and lanyard loop. We can certainly clean up your 184 like Rich mentioned. I should say that sometimes when we reblast a Buckmaster, it uncovers pits. This is especially true if the knife has any rust like yours appears to. We cant remove the pits if they appear. Still, the knife will look very nice when we are done.
